POSITION OVERVIEW The Office of Council Member Tiffany D. Thomas seeks a proactive and community-minded Public Service & Community Engagement Associate to support and amplify the office’s mission of equitable service delivery. This position will assist with constituent services, communications, administrative operations, and public-facing events across District F’s diverse communities.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
Constituent Services- Support the Constituent Services Manager by assisting with 311 service requests, tracking cases, and corresponding with residents.
- Prepare case updates, community issue reports, and assist with proactive resident engagement activities.
Communications Support- Draft and edit materials for newsletters, social media, and public announcements under the Director of Communications’ direction.
- Assist in tracking local news coverage and community trends.
- Support the preparation of visual materials (flyers, graphics) using templates when needed.
Administrative Operations- Provide internal office support, including meeting preparation, calendar assistance, document organization, and financial reconciliation.
- Maintain databases, RSVP lists, event portfolios, and internal logs.
- Assist with logistics for staff meetings and briefings.
Community Engagement & Event Staffing- Staff District F events, including workshops, town halls, and special activations (occasional evenings and weekends with notice).
- Support event setup, guest management, vendor coordination, and material logistics.
- Staff Council Member or Chief of Staff at District F community meetings and events.
Work Structure- 30 hours per week, flexible scheduling in coordination with the Chief of Staff.
- Some evening and weekend event work required with advance notice.
